→Read MoreDiscover Kalamazoo Sports reports hosting 70+ sports events in 2023, which resulted in $28.5 million in estimated direct visitor spending.
More than 30,000 youth, amateur, college and professional athletes competed in various sports events and tournaments held in the Kalamazoo area, contributing to the region’s local economy by discovering Kalamazoo through a combination of activities such as lodging, transportation, food & beverage, retail, recreation, space rental, and other business services.
